+ # If the binaryen interpreter hit a host limitation then do not
+ # run other VMs, as that is risky: the host limitation may be an
+ # an OOM which could be very costly (lots of swapping, and the
+ # OOM may change after opts that remove allocations etc.), or it
+ # might be an atomic wait which other VMs implement fully (and
+ # the wait might be very long). In general host limitations
+ # should be rare (which can be verified by looking at the
+ # details of how many things we ended up ignoring), and when we
+ # see one we are in a situation that we can't fuzz properly.
+ if vm == self.bynterpreter and vm_results[vm] == IGNORE:
+ print('(ignored, so not running other VMs)')
+
+ # the ignoring should have been noted during run_vms()
+ assert(ignored_vm_runs > ignored_before)
+
+ return vm_results
